side note; a workflow problem I have with current darcs-record that 
isn't totally fixed by hunk-splitting existing;

when I have a lot of hunks to record, into a few different patches, I 
wish I could go through them in one darcs-record session and sort them 
into the several different "bins" (patches I want to create).  Instead I 
have to go through them once, to record one of the patches and kinda 
half memorize what I'm going to do with the rest, and then go through 
all the hunks again in a second darcs-record (hit n / y too slowly? get 
bored. Too fast? don't have enough time to see the next hunk coming, and 
sometimes press the wrong answer..), and then a third record session...

hunk splitting does mean that I don't as likely have to repeatedly quit 
mid-record to get any one patch to be what I want it to be, so total 
frustration does decrease :-)
